The point on the Earth's surface directly above the focus is called the earthquake epicentre. Scientists study earthquakes because they want to know more about their causes and predict where they are likely to happen. They also need to know how the ground moves during earthquakes. This information helps scientists and engineers build safer buildings - especially important buildings in an emergency, like hospitals and government buildings. As we have seen, most earthquakes are essentially the product of tectonic stresses which are generated at the boundaries of the Earth's tectonic plates.The released energy travels as shock waves, called seismic waves, which may be felt and measured.The study of seismic waves is known as seismology, a word derived from a Greek word meaning "to shake." San Francisco earthquake of 1989, also called Loma Prieta earthquake, major earthquake that struck the San Francisco Bay Area, California, U.S., on October 17, 1989, and caused 63 deaths, nearly 3,800 injuries, and an estimated $6 billion in property damage. These so-called tectonic earthquakes are generated by the rapid release of strain energy that is stored within the rocks of the crust, which on continents is about 22 miles (35 kilometers) thick. The largest-known quake in the United States struck Prince William Sound, Alaska, on March 28, 1964, and measured magnitude 9.2.
